What Is a Multilayer PCB?

A multilayer PCB contains three or more conductive copper layers laminated together into a single structure.

Common Challenges in Multilayer PCB Manufacturing

Warpage and Mechanical Stress

Uneven copper distribution and thermal imbalance may lead to:

  • PCB bow and twist
  • Reflow deformation
  • Assembly instability

Internal Link: PCB Warpage and Reflow Deformation – Common issue in complex multilayer structures.

Signal Integrity Issues

Poor stack-up planning can increase:

  • Crosstalk
  • EMI
  • Impedance variation

Delamination Risk

Improper lamination may cause separation between layers during thermal cycling.

Manufacturing Yield Reduction

Higher layer counts increase fabrication complexity and production risk.

Best Practices for Multilayer PCB Design

  • Use symmetrical stack-ups
  • Balance copper distribution
  • Separate signal and power layers properly
  • Minimize unnecessary vias
  • Perform fabrication-oriented DFM review early

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What is a multilayer PCB supplier?

A multilayer PCB supplier manufactures boards with three or more conductive layers.

Q2: Why are multilayer PCBs more expensive?

Additional lamination, drilling, and process control increase manufacturing complexity.

Q3: What industries use multilayer PCBs?

Automotive, communication, industrial, medical, and computing industries commonly use multilayer designs.

Q4: How many layers can a multilayer PCB have?

Modern PCBs may contain more than 20 layers depending on application requirements.

Q5: What is the biggest challenge in multilayer PCB fabrication?

Maintaining registration accuracy and thermal stability across all layers.
